Testing Before Launch

Before publishing any new product, it's essential to test how No Humans Allowed on the Couch looks in real-world scenarios. Start by creating mockups for various products, such as t-shirts, mugs, and tote bags. Check how the design holds up under different lighting conditions and backgrounds. Ensure that the transparency in the PNG file is clean and doesn’t leave unwanted white spaces or artifacts.

Also, consider how the design will appear as a marketplace thumbnail. A strong, eye-catching preview can significantly increase click-through rates. Test the design on dark and light backgrounds to ensure visibility and contrast. If you're planning to use it for print-on-demand products, verify the resolution and color accuracy to maintain quality across different materials and finishes.

Cautionary Notes and Risk Assessment

While No Humans Allowed on the Couch is a great asset, there are some situations where it may not perform as well. Avoid using it in tiny sticker details or text-heavy templates where clarity is crucial. The design might also struggle on low-resolution print products or crowded thumbnails, where it could get lost among other visuals.

Be mindful of dark backgrounds, as they can reduce the contrast and make the design less visible. If you're planning to use it for Cricut or Silhouette projects, inspect the SVG cut quality to ensure that the lines are clean and precise. Always confirm that you have a commercial license before selling finished products, as this is a key legal consideration for digital product creators.
